[1.7.10] How to know if a block was placed by the player or by the generator?


Recommended Posts

Posted

Hi guys,

 

how do you know if a block was placed by a player or by the world generator? The reason I need this is simple. I created a block that has a TileEntity linked to it.

 

When this block is placed by the player, the TileEntity will rotate and face the player.

 

But when the block is placed by the World Generator, I would like to rotate it randomly.

 

I notice that the Block method "OnBlockAdded" is called when the block is placed by the generator. So I thought I could use it to set randomly its rotation right in there in the metadata.

 

BUT the same method is also called when the block is added manually by the player ...

 

So how could I know if the block was placed by the player or by the generator?

Posted

Make the generator apply the random rotation.
